Native sources have confirmed that the Rafale fourth-generation fighters, presently on order for the Serbian Air Power, may have downgraded air-to-air capabilities. This ensures that they are going to pose a restricted problem to NATO air energy, ought to Belgrade align its insurance policies with the preferences of the Western Bloc.
Serbian President Aleksandar Vucic first introduced the deal to accumulate the fighters on April 9, following discussions along with his French counterpart, Emmanuel Macron. Whereas the Rafale is considered a contemporary fighter, it has comparatively restricted air-to-air efficiency in comparison with different Western fighters. The plane’s engines are among the many weakest of any fighter in manufacturing, and its small radar lacks the ability of rivals just like the F-15’s AN/APG-82 and the F-35’s AN/APG-81.
Its vary and missile-carrying capability are additionally significantly decrease in comparison with high-performing fighters just like the Russian Su-30, the Chinese language J-16, and the American F-15. Nonetheless, Rafales in Serbian service will expertise a major discount of their air-to-air capabilities as a result of a ban on the supply of Meteor air-to-air missiles, that are the fighter’s main armament. Different potential downgrades stay unconfirmed.
The Meteor missile was designed to surpass the American AIM-120, and it reportedly benefitted from key U.S. expertise transfers. Launched in 2016, the Meteor boasts a superior vary and kinematic efficiency in comparison with the AIM-120. One in all its standout options is its propulsion system, which extra intently resembles that of a cruise missile as a result of its reliance on a variable-flow ducted rocket [ramjet] as an alternative of a conventional rocket motor.
This capacity permits the missiles to manage their engine throughout flight quite than burning by way of their vitality in a single unmodulated burst. Consequently, they’ll preserve extra energy for the terminal assault part, enabling them to carry out excessive maneuvers and climb rapidly, making them a lot tougher to evade.
The Meteor missile is likely one of the few options that hold the Rafale’s efficiency on par with main American and Chinese language counterparts. The Meteors are thought of corresponding to the American AIM-260 missile, the Chinese language PL-15, and the Russian R-77M. With out the Meteor missiles, Serbian Rafale fighters would lack any long-range air-to-air functionality, relying solely on the medium-range MICA missile as their main armament.
Blocking the sale of the Meteor missile to sure shoppers isn’t with out precedent. For instance, Rafale fighters provided to Egypt confronted comparable restrictions. This aligns with a longstanding Western coverage of limiting Egypt’s entry to superior air-to-air property. Consequently, Egypt’s F-16 fighters should depend on the getting older AIM-7 missile from the Chilly Struggle period, which is even much less succesful than the MICA missile. Moreover, Egypt’s French-supplied Mirage 2000s face much more stringent limitations.
As Serbia prepares to make its first-ever acquisition of Western fighter plane, it’s clear that comparable restrictions will apply. This implies Serbian Rafale fighters shall be among the many least succesful in air-to-air fight in Jap Europe. In distinction, international locations within the area are upgrading to extra superior choices, such because the F-35, whereas Croatia is buying Rafales outfitted with Meteors, and Slovakia is buying F-16 Block 70s armed with trendy AIM-120 variants.
It’s price noting that the Serbian Air Power’s new Rafale jets will even have a shorter air-to-air engagement vary in comparison with the MiG-29s presently of their fleet. Whereas the MiG-29s use R-77-1 missiles with a spread of 110 kilometers, the Rafale’s MICA missiles are restricted to 80 kilometers. The MiG-29 additionally outperforms the Rafale by way of pace and flight capabilities, though Serbia’s present variants lag behind by way of trendy avionics.
As soon as seen as a prime contender for the most recent MiG-29 fashions just like the MiG-29M or the superior MiG-35, Serbia shifted its focus as a result of elevated financial sanctions from Western nations within the late 2010s. Had they acquired these trendy MiG variants, Serbian pilots would have benefited from superior AESA radars, enabling them to deploy R-77M missiles corresponding to the Meteor and probably far-reaching R-37M missiles.
Serbia’s determination to accumulate Rafale fighters has stirred fairly a debate on the house entrance. The nation nonetheless vividly remembers the extreme NATO bombings of the Nineteen Nineties and views Western-supplied plane with comprehensible skepticism. Many Serbians consider these fighters would supply little sensible use if conflicts reignite.
Whereas Belgrade has shied away from shopping for Russian air protection methods as a result of potential Western sanctions, there was additionally discuss choosing the Chinese language J-10C fighter as an alternative of the Rafale. This selection may replicate Serbia’s impartial stance amidst ongoing NATO-Russian tensions.
The Serbian authorities’s want to strengthen financial ties with the European Union appears to be the driving drive behind its curiosity in Western fighter jets. Curiously, non-Western sources typically present plane with out sacrifices in efficiency, including one other layer to the talk.
France, in contrast to america, imposes fewer restrictions on how its fighters may be utilized by non-allied nations. This flexibility has made the Rafale engaging to international locations like India, Indonesia, and the United Arab Emirates. In distinction, American fighters such because the F-15 and F-35, regardless of their superior capabilities, typically include political strings connected.
